Maynard Ferguson Tribute Band

Maynard Ferguson Tribute Band. Mark Van Cleave leads this tribute to the Boss with the Velocity Big Be-Bop Band playing many of the Maynard Ferguson classics along with some brand new arrangements in the Maynard Ferguson tradition.
